These are the first 100 kanji I studied. I plan on doing 19-20 in all, in 100-kanji increments.

Notice I said studied, not necessarily learned. The colors represent how wel I learned them at the time of my self-test. The green kanji are the ones I know the meaning and the primary reading (as in, the reading that comes to mind when you see the kanji), the blue kanji are the ones I know one but not the other for, and the red kanji are the ones I know neither for.

Yes I am aware there are, like, 10 readings for some kanji, but I only have so much space, so I gave 2 lines for kun-yomi (Japanese readings) and one space for on-yomi (Chinese readings). I looked them up on JWP and picked the most prominent (?) and/or different ones.

I double-checked everything on a Japanese word processor called JWPce.

Oh! Before I forget, I should say I studied the kanji in no official order. I'm both studying them in the order presented in Kanji de Manga, and studying first the words I most want to learn.
